The accumulated net income of a corporation is called its

Respuesta :

katealvarez7
katealvarez7 katealvarez7
  • 04-11-2020

Answer:

retained earnings

Explanation:

Accumulated income, also known as retained earnings, includes the portion of net income that is retained by a corporation over time, rather than being distributed as dividends. Any accumulated income is typically used by the corporation to reinvest in its principal business or to pay down its debt.
